Symptoms

  • •Engine struggles to maintain speed on inclines
  • •Unusual engine noises or vibrations when accelerating
  • •Check Engine light illuminated
  • •Decreased fuel efficiency
  • •Transmission slipping or delayed shifting
  • •Overheating engine temperature gauge

Solution
1. Preparation
  • Gather tools: OBD-II scanner, fuel pressure gauge, multimeter, socket set, torque wrench.
  • Ensure the vehicle is parked on a flat surface, engage the parking brake, and disconnect the battery for safety.
2. Address Engine Codes
  • Connect the OBD-II scanner to the vehicle's diagnostic port.
  • Retrieve and note any error codes.
  • Clear the codes and take the vehicle for a test drive to see if they return, indicating persistent issues.
3. Replace Air Filter
  • Locate the air filter housing.
  • Remove the screws or clips securing the housing.
  • Take out the old air filter and clean the housing.
  • Install a new air filter, ensuring it fits securely, and reassemble the housing.
4. Fuel Pressure Test
  • Locate the fuel rail and remove the Schrader valve cap.
  • Connect the fuel pressure gauge to the Schrader valve.
  • Turn the ignition to the "ON" position without starting the engine and check the pressure reading; it should be within manufacturer specifications (typically around 55-62 psi).
  • If pressure is low, replace the fuel pump.
5. Transmission Fluid Check
  • Locate the transmission dipstick (if applicable).
  • Remove the dipstick and wipe it clean, then reinsert and remove again to check fluid level.
  • If low, add the appropriate transmission fluid until it reaches the full mark.
  • If the fluid is dark or burnt-smelling, consider a transmission fluid change.
6. Clean Throttle Body
  • Remove the intake duct to access the throttle body.
  • Use throttle body cleaner and a soft cloth to clean the throttle plate and surrounding area.
  • Reassemble the intake duct and reconnect any sensors or hoses.
